You may not be able to fix it. Zirconium columns have a different chemical structure than silica. They are more pH resistant and can be used at elevated temperatures, but they run differently than a silica Ci8. First, find out if it has a chemically bonded tetraphosphonic acid chelator. If not, you may have to add a chelator to the mobile phase. If you are not getting sharp peaks, make sure you have made new inlet tubing specifically for this column. Old tubing can ruin the performance of a new column. Run a standard mix on both columns and see how they differ. This column can give you the ability to separate mixture that you can t separate on a reverse-phase silica column. [Pg.210]

Whole Blood. It is recommended that the samples be cautiously handled from the start of the collection to maintain integrity and preclude the possibility of contamination, tampering, or mislabeling. All samples should be collected under the close supervision of a health care provider/ physician, and if possible, witnessed by an unbiased observer. Samples should be obtained as soon as possible following the suspected exposure. Additional follow-up samples may be obtained. Blood should be collected in 5 or 7 mL blood tubes. Specific methods may require specific types of tubes, such as purple-top (EDTA) tubes for plasma, or the red-top mbes for serum and vacuum-fill only (unopened). [Pg.503]

Shapiro (1977) defined the speed index, S = ulc, similar to die Mach number in gas dynamics, and demonstrated different cases of subcritical (5 < 1) and supercritical (S > 1) flows. It has been shown experimentally in simple experiments with compliant tubes that gradual reduction of the downstream pressure progressively increases the flow rate until a maximal value is reached (Holt, 1969 Conrad, 1969). The one-dimensional theory demonstrates that for a given tube (specific geometry and wall properties) and boundary conditions, the maximal steady flow that can be conveyed in a collapsible tube is attained for 5 = I (e.g., when u = c) at some position along the tube (Dawson Elliott, 1977 Shapiro, 1977 Elad et id., 1989). In this case, the flow is said to be choked and further reduction in downstream pressure does not affect the flow upstream of the flow-limiting site. Much of its complexity, however, is still unresolved either experimentally or theoretically (Kamm et al., 1982 Kanun and Pedley, 1989 Elad et al., 1992). [Pg.89]

Accounting that supercritical water and carbon dioxide are the most widely used fluids and that the majority of experiments were performed in circular tubes, specifics of heat transfer and pressure drop, including generalized correlations, will be discussed in this paper based on these conditions. Specifics of heat transfer and pressure drop at other conditions and/or for other fluids are discussed in the book by Pioro and Duffey (2007). [Pg.798]
